Can we offer more than one book, or a choice of books?
Is there a theme to this (e.g., mysteries, romances, etc), or can we choose any book to offer?


So, there's definitely not a theme. Any book that you think a PBT member will love is fine.
As for offering more than one book, you need to pick ONE for the official swap, but you can either a) include a bonus book that won't be revealed until the end of the swap. When your title is opened, we will indicate it comes with a bonus book, but that title will not be revealed, or b) you can wait until the end of the swap and then offer the person who ended up with your book the opportunity to select from others you may be willing to part with.
Let me know if that's a clear answer . . .as it seems a bit confusing to write!

1. You must sign up for the swap and submit your title by February 29th. The swap will begin on March 4.
2. When you sign up, you must provide the title and author of the paperback book you will be donating to me via private message.
3. Paperback books may be used or new, but should be in good condition. Please try to pick a book you know you LOVE and that you'd really enjoy sharing with a fellow PBT member.
4. Here's how the swap will work.
- The order of play will be generated at random.
- The first person will select a number from a list of numbers that I provide. Each number is affiliated with a book title. I, then, announce which book the first person has opened.
- The second person can either steal the open title from the first person. Or, they may pick a new number and open a new book. If they steal the first person's title, then the first person has the opportunity to select a new number.
- The third person may then steal either one of the open titles, or select a new number to open.
We continue ad infinitum until all the books are opened and distributed.
5. Each person may possess a given title no more than three times total.
6. One title will come with a $25 Amazon gift certificate provided by PBT. At the end of the swap, we will announce which title includes the gift certificate.
7. You must check the status of the swap every 24 hours or assign a proxy person to do so for you so that if it is your turn, you take it in a timely fashion.
8. Because of the gift certificate, this swap is only open to PBT members who are existing members as February 29th, or who are WELL known to an existing long term PBT member who is willing to vouch for you.
We love new members and will be very happy to have you participate in upcoming activities and celebrations - - many of which have prizes - - but this is a significant prize, and we really intend it for people who have been participating here and/or helped PBT become the great group it is today.
9. Book should be shipped within one week of the close of the swap.
Personal contact information must be exchanged between the two parties involved - - privately - - in order to complete the shipping of the books. Not shipping your book is grounds for being removed as a PBT member (holy smokes I seriously hope I never actually have to implement that!).
Please note that we've had very successful swaps in the past with little or no problems.
Admins may participate (but I will not as I am running it and will know all the books).
